decivilize
To make less civilized.
Verb
- To make less civilized.
- Are we not in fact dicivilizing ourselves as we decivilize them? Why is there no outcry? Is it because we have cast off the delusion of human sanctity? - 2005, Marilynne Robinson, The Death of Adam: Essays on Modern...
- To become less civilized.
- Or how beings such as ourselves—such as you now are— with lifespans measured in centuries and strength and endurance far beyond that of Terra- born humans, could decivilize so utterly? - 2003, David Weber, Empire from...
Origin
From de- + civilize.
